As far as gear goes, bring whatever you (or your husband) normally uses for rec climbing: harness, helmet, throwline, throw weights, 150' rope etc.

People who come in by plane bring the max gear they can take on the flight, people traveling in vehicles usually bring everything but the kitchen sink.

People who sleep in trees usually bring their own setup, usually either a portaledge or a New Tribe Treeboat. Check out the New Tribe web site for more info on tree boats.
